Подсветка синтаксиса для MicroEmacs - PullRequest
1 голос
/ 26 августа 2009

Как включить синтаксис для MicroEmacs?

Я безуспешно вставил следующее в мой файл uelocal_rc в моем ДОМЕ.

add-global-mode "HILITE"

Я также неудачно поставил следующую команду и для .emacs, и для uelocal_rc в моем ДОМЕ.

(require 'font-lock)    ; enable syntax highlighting

Это говорит о том, что .emacs не манипулирует Mg. Также возможно, что имя файла uelocal_rc неверно, так как я не смог найти ни одного примера таких файлов в Google и в Github.

Я использую свежую установку Ubuntu, в которой стандартный Emacs не имеет подсветки синтаксиса.

Я, наконец, изменил окончания файлов на .el, но проблема остается.

Я скачал источник MicroEmacs по

apt-get source mg

Однако я не нашел никакого файла справки по ack-grep -i help/readme.

Я добавил следующие строки в мой .zshrc безуспешно.

# MicroEmacs                                                                    
export MEINSTALLPATH="/home/masi/"
export MEPATH="/home/masi/"
export MEUSERPATH='/home/masi/'

1 Ответ

2 голосов
/ 26 августа 2009

Я не знаком с MicroEmacs, но есть подробная глава по Профили пользователей в документации MicroEmacs .

Профиль частного пользователя хранится в отдельный каталог. Каталог что MicroEmacs обычно использует автоматически создается при запуске, но может быть создан вручную пользователем. Если каталог должен быть помещен в специальное место, то $ MEUSERPATH (5) среда переменная должна быть определена и установлена ​​в указать на это местоположение каталога.

[...]

Файл запуска пользователя $ user-name.emf (см. emf (8) ). Обычно это называется « user.emf » в документации и означает, что пользователи частные MicroEmacs файл макроса. Пользователь может сделать локальным изменения в MicroEmacs в этом файле, это может включать определение нового ключа привязки, определяющие новые функции хуков и т. д. Вы должны переопределить стандарт Настройки MicroEmacs с вашего запуска файл, а не изменение стандартные файлы MicroEmacs.

И да, он пропускает синтаксический анализ .emacs в соответствии с EmacsWiki , поскольку «у меня нет EmacsLisp, но есть свой собственный язык расширений».

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...